Latest Patents
Avevor's latest patents include a "Device for independently inflating, deflating, supplying contrast media to and monitoring up to two balloon catheters for angioplasty." This adaptable inflation device features a plurality of three-port valves that control flow to two fluid channels, each coupled at an outlet to a balloon catheter for angioplasty. A single inline pressure gauge, which may be removable, monitors the pressure of each channel. The device allows for various operations, including sequential and simultaneous inflation and deflation, as well as the ability to inflate to the same or different pressures.
Another significant patent is the "Expandable device for independently inflating, deflating, supplying contrast media to and monitoring up to two balloon catheters for angioplasty." Similar to his previous invention, this device also includes three-port valves and inline pressure gauges to monitor the pressure of each channel. It provides the same operational capabilities, enhancing the versatility and functionality of balloon catheter procedures.
